What magicka spell is good against dragons?

Post » Sun Jun 10, 2012 7:41 pm

This is my second character in Skyrim, level 4, magic only - no weapons, no bows and arrows, no summoned weapons, but can use bought enchanted armor of any kind. Expert difficulty. My upgraded lightning bolt is very weak against a normal dragon and my magicka is slow to regenerate. I lasted 10 minutes against Mr. dragon once, but he's too powerful and absorbs damage. So I had to duck unto a cave and wait for him to leave. I take it dragons have magicka resist?

Lightning destruction spells + dragonrend shout. With enough hits, the lightning will evuentually drain all their magica (obviously the more powerful the spell (and perks), the faster you will drain the magica).

So basically the dragon can't fly with dragonrend and can't breath fire at you since his magica is all gone, making him a sitting duck. The only drawback to this strategy is that you need a ton of magica and magica regeneration cause the dragon can just regenerate their magica.

Get thee to the college. You need magica buffs at early levels to make it useful. Get Dual Cast and although you get little in extra damage you can stagger targets for long enough to get off another one. Then repeat till you win.

Again you need robes, hood and jewelery to buff your magica to a useful level. Always take magica as your choice for the first while, then some stamina to help the essential kiting skills to express themselves well.

Oh yeah, get an Atronach to distract the enemy. The Flame one is available at any level I believe.

At Level 4, using magic only, you're going to have to do lots and lots of kiting, with frequent breaks to regenerate mana and chug healing potions, to take on a dragon. Even with weapons, it's going to be a long, hard battle.

I would either pick up a follower to help with the dragon fights, or avoid dragons completely until you've leveled up some and increased your mana pool. It goes without saying that at your level, as a mage, you should be putting every level-up into magicka.

ETA - my mage is Level 25 and has completed the College quest line, so she has the Archmage's Robes plus his amulet, giving her a pool of 440 magicka with these items equipped, plus a 125% mana regen rate. She can handle dragon encounters pretty easily now.

Also fire breathing dragons are weak to frost, and the other way around. Their resistance -50% so they take 1.5 times the normal damage from the element they are weak to.

Alchemy is nice to get some resistances. One can combine ingredients to get a combined fire and frost resistance potion. No need to carry two different potions for each type of damage. They will raise your resistance against a dragon's fire or frost attack for 60 seconds. Potions to fortify destruction will make your destruction spells more powerful (more damage), and potions for conjuration will make conjuration spells last longer.

Not much you can do as such a low level. Frost spells help to slow the fire breathers a bit when it's on the ground, but you'll definitely need help from a follower. Fire vs frost-breathers. Finding/buying elemental protective gear will be almost essential against the dragons (and mages), so be on the lookout for that kinda stuff.

As you progress, you'll want to hunt down the Marked for Death shout. Even powered by one Word, it's effective against low-level dragons Being able to summon a Storm Atronach will be a big help, as well. The ability to zap dragons in the air and serve as a distraction will help you recover from damage and prepare your next attacks.

You can also acquire the perk for Restoration, when a Ward is hit with a spell it replenishes Magicka. Wards+Destruction+Thrall=Unfettered Powerful Mage.
